In the summer of 2010 a huge piece of ice roughly four times the area of Manhattan and 500 m thick caved off the Greenland mainland. Required:
a. How much heat would be required to melt this iceberg (assumed to be at 0°C) into liquid water at 0°C?
b. The annual U. S. energy consumption is 1.2 x 10^20 J. If all the U. S. energy was used to melt the ice, how many days would it take to do so?
